I downloaded a WP plug-in, don't remember the name although if somebody wants to know I can look it up, I think it's WP-polls.

Anyway after the person votes it just changes the widget to display results and I would like after the person votes that it goes to a new blog page with voting results so I can put a CPA offer on that page.

Is it possible to modify this script to display a new page after voting? Or is there another free poll software/script I can install on WP?

I guess I have to double post this, anyways, I did a quick look. Inside polls.php, on line 599 or so, you can see the end of the function display_pollresult. I think you might be able to do a js include there that waits 3 to 5 seconds and then directs you to a new page.
